What is Managed IT?

Managed IT refers to the outsourcing of information technology (IT) responsibilities to a third-party provider, known as a Managed Service Provider (MSP). 7 Questions Businesses Should Ask a Prospective Managed Service Provider (MSP)

It Service

How responsive and available is your support team when we need assistance?

Ensure the MSP communicates the way that your team needs them to. Dig deeper with questions such as:

  • What are your standard response and resolution times for remote vs. onsite support?
  • Do you offer 24/7 support or only during business hours?
  • Is there a live person available when we call, or is it an automated system?
  • How are service tickets created, tracked, and escalated?
  • Are local technicians available for urgent onsite needs?

What security protocols and certifications do you follow to protect our data and systems?

Make sure that the MSP has best practices in place to secure the credentials and access that you entrust them with. Dig deeper with questions such as:

  • Are you SOC 2 and/or HIPAA compliant?
  • How do you manage and store credentials?
  • What endpoint protection and monitoring tools do you use?
  • Do you conduct regular security audits or penetration testing?
  • How do you handle data backups and disaster recovery?

What is your process for evaluating our IT environment and onboarding us as a client?

Ensure the MSP has a standardized protocol for learning about your systems and needs to provide accurate estimates without surprise increases or add-ons after they secure your business.

How do you handle offboarding and ensure a smooth transition if we end our partnership?

Ensure the MSP has an efficient way to securely provide you with all of your IT documentation, so you have an accurate and current picture of your devices, users, licenses, and IT infrastructure. Dig deeper with questions such as:

  • Will we receive full documentation of our IT environment, including credentials, configurations, and licenses?
  • Are there any fees or restrictions associated with offboarding?
  • How long does it take to complete the offboarding process?
  • Do you assist with transitioning to a new provider?

What does your service agreement include (and exclude)?

Ensure the MSP has a clearly defined Scope of Work (SOW) within the Managed Services Agreement (MSA) to avoid surprise gaps in service and unexpected billing. Dig deeper with questions such as:

  • What services are included in your standard agreement?
  • Are there any limitations, exclusions, or additional fees we should be aware of?
  • How do you handle out-of-scope requests?

5 Ways to Plan Smarter for IT Procurement

Forecast Future Needs

Avoid reactive purchases by planning ahead for business growth, employee turnover, and changing technology requirements.

Standardize Equipment

Using consistent hardware across your organization simplifies support, reduces compatibility issues, and streamlines procurement.

Track Asset Lifecycles

Track when devices are due for replacement or warranty expiration to prevent unexpected failures and manage budgets proactively.

Bundle for Better Pricing

Work with your MSP to bundle hardware, software licensing, and support services for greater cost savings and simplified, streamlined billing.

Align IT with Business Goals

Procurement strategies should support your broader business objectives—whether that’s scaling operations, improving security, or enabling remote work.

6 Threats That Target Outdated Systems

Unpatched Vulnerabilities

Hackers often exploit known flaws in outdated operating systems and software that haven’t been patched or properly updated over time.

Ransomware Attacks

Older systems lacking security updates are prime targets for ransomware, which can encrypt your data and demand payment for its return.

Phishing Exploits

Without updated email filters and DNS protection, phishing emails are more likely to reach users and trick them into revealing sensitive information.

Malware Injections

Outdated antivirus definitions and unpatched browsers can allow malicious code to run undetected on your network.

Firewall Bypass

Legacy firewalls may not recognize or block modern attack patterns, leaving your network perimeter exposed to newer and more sophisticated threats.

Credential Theft

Without regular updates to authentication protocols and endpoint protection, attackers can more easily steal or guess login credentials.

6 Reasons to Engage an IT Consultant

Technology Planning Gaps

When internal teams are focused on day-to-day operations, consultants help map out long-term IT strategies aligned with business goals.

Budgeting Uncertainty

Consultants bring experience in forecasting IT costs, helping you avoid surprise expenses and plan for scalable growth.

Tool & Vendor Selection

With knowledge of current platforms and vendor ecosystems, consultants can recommend the right tools for your needs—saving time and money.

Security & Compliance Concerns

Certified consultants (e.g., CISSP, CISM) can assess risks, recommend controls, and help you meet industry-specific compliance requirements.

Project Overload

When your internal team is stretched thin, consultants can step in to manage or support complex IT projects from planning to execution.

Cloud Migration Strategy

Consultants help evaluate readiness, select the right cloud model, and ensure a smooth transition with minimal disruption.
